Output 58f3dcd3593dd7e5c8bc28adfe7dcee537d95eb7b5645759d8a487dc5785b9d4:1

value
56182
script pubkey
OP_0 OP_PUSHBYTES_20 1fb13a2239e32dc315ff097ccdc4aa2af2fab2ac
address
bc1qr7cn5g3euvkux90lp97vm3929te04v4vpcdjqf
transaction
58f3dcd3593dd7e5c8bc28adfe7dcee537d95eb7b5645759d8a487dc5785b9d4
confirmations
42504
spent
true